Tricoci University of Beauty Culture-Chicago NE vs Loyola University Chicago
Chicago, IL — Chicago, IL
| Metric | Tricoci University of Beauty Culture-Chicago NE Chicago, IL | Loyola University Chicago Chicago, IL |
|---|---|---|
| Location | Chicago, IL | Chicago, IL |
| Type | Private For-Profit | Private Nonprofit |
| Total Enrollment | 160 | 11,737 |
| Acceptance Rate | — | 81.6% |
| SAT Average | — | 1,297 |
| In-State Tuition | — | $53,710 |
| Out-of-State Tuition | — | $53,710 |
| Avg Net Price | $19,279 | $36,079 |
| Median Debt at Graduation | $7,307 | $24,157 |
| 4-Year Graduation Rate | — | 74.9% |
| Retention Rate | — | 81.7% |
| Median Earnings (6 yr) | $23,925 | $58,411 |
| Median Earnings (10 yr) | $27,330 | $71,530 |

Frequently Asked Questions
How do Tricoci University of Beauty Culture-Chicago NE and Loyola University Chicago compare?▼
Tricoci University of Beauty Culture-Chicago NE (Chicago, IL) has no published acceptance rate, in-state tuition of —, and median 10-year earnings of $27,330. Loyola University Chicago (Chicago, IL) has an acceptance rate of 81.6%, in-state tuition of $53,710, and median 10-year earnings of $71,530.
Which school has higher graduate earnings, Tricoci University of Beauty Culture-Chicago NE or Loyola University Chicago?▼
Loyola University Chicago graduates earn more at 10 years out, with a median of $71,530 vs $27,330. Source: U.S. Department of Education College Scorecard.
Which school is more affordable, Tricoci University of Beauty Culture-Chicago NE or Loyola University Chicago?▼
Based on average net price (after grants and scholarships), Tricoci University of Beauty Culture-Chicago NE is the more affordable option at $19,279 per year versus $36,079.
